"Jetpack Dreams" chronicles the colorful pop history and science of that most amazing and mysterious of machines: the jetpack.
Fueled by a fascination and lifelong obsession with the power of flight, journalist Mac Montandon goes on a vastly entertaining search of the elusive invention. He examines the jetpackOCOs inspiration from the first shoulder-mounted wings to Bill SuitorOCOs 1984 Olympic flight, even uncovering a gruesome jetpack-related murder in Houston. From the earliest days of the OCOpack to its enduring role in popular culture?with Buck Rogers, James Bond, Boba Fett?Montandon seeks to answer two simple questions: Where is the jetpack that was promised to him, and to all of us, years ago? And if itOCOs out there, can he catch a ride?"
